Asarco sheds environmental liabilities & oversees its own cleanup (fox watching the chickencoop) and the Labor Union cooperates...
"....The union's support has been reciprocal. Last week in Hayden, as Asarco argued its position for leading an environmental cleanup there instead of letting the federal government designate it a Superfund site, the union was at the company's side. United Steelworkers representative Tony Meza told Hayden town officials to let Asarco manage the cleanup...."
from: Asarco, unions achieve harmony: Turnaround in labor relations credited to bankruptcy court's takeover in 2005
